poppytree, the Dr Suess has serrated leaves and the Charles Grimaldi has smooth edged leaves.If you have the CG be thankful as some of us that thought we had the CG found that we actually had Dr Suess.Confusing isn't it? LOL
poppytree, that fits the description of jamaican yellow. JY is supposed to be one of the very few yellow brugs that does not turn gold. i believe CG goes gold as well. it is really hard to ID brugs from pics as the flowers can change according to time of the year, time of day, growing conditions, etc. i have blooms on the same plants now that are much smaller than the normal flowers on the plants at the same time! i had two IDed from pics last year that were IDed wrong.
